titleOfInvention | Porcine uroplakin ii promoter and the production method of useful proteins using said promoter |
abstract | The present invention relates to a porcine uroplakin II gene promoter, an expression vector containing the promoter, and a method for producing useful proteins using the vector. The promoter of the present invention promotes the bladder-specific expression of a target protein at high efficiency. An animal, which was transformed using the inventive promoter so as to express the target protein, secretes the target protein in its urine at high concentration, and the protein thus produced shows a superior physiological activity to that of the same kind of the existing protein. As a result, the inventive promoter, the expression vector and transgenic animal using the promoter, can be advantageously used in the production field of useful proteins that are medicinally valuable. |
